PCU Coolant Circuit Inspection

WARNING: This page is about a different variant/trim than selected.

NOTE:  Before testing, check for DTCs. If any DTCs are indicated, troubleshoot the indicated DTCs first.

Visual check

Check that the opening of the front bumper is not blocked with dust, and clean it if needed.

Check the radiator, the A/C condenser, and the fan shroud assembly for the following conditions, and repair them if needed:

Cooling circuit check:

Check for these conditions at the cooling line, and repair if needed:

3. Expansion tank cap check

Test the expansion tank cap, and replace it if needed .

DTC check (PCU electric coolant pump)

Connect the HDS to the DLC .

-2. Turn the vehicle to the ON mode.

-3. Select the Electric Powertrain in the System Selection Menu.

-4. Clear any stored DTCs.

-5. Turn the vehicle to the OFF (LOCK) mode.

-6. Turn the vehicle to the ON mode.

-7. Select the ELECTRIC WATER PUMP TEST in the Electric Powertrain FUNCTION TEST with the HDS, then select START.

Check for Pending or Confirmed DTCs with the HDS.
